Map content is loading...

Romeo's Place

180 Trans-Canada Highway, Duncan , British Columbia V9L 3P9

Contacts

Food Restaurant

180 Trans-Canada Highway,
Duncan, British Columbia
V9L 3P9

Get directions

+1 250-746-9944

Opening hours Closed now

Tomorrow: 11:00 am — 09:00 pm

Sunday
11:00 am — 09:00 pm
Monday
11:00 am — 09:00 pm
Tuesday
11:00 am — 09:00 pm
Wednesday
11:00 am — 09:00 pm
Thursday
11:00 am — 09:00 pm
Friday
11:00 am — 10:00 pm
Saturday
11:00 am — 10:00 pm

Ratings & Reviews


(3.5 / 5) based on 4 reviews

How would you rate this?
Share this Get directions Write a review Suggest an update

Reviews

  • Good food, their pizza is loaded and their pizza sauce is very good. I also really enjoy their pastas and their Greek salad is so good as well. Great place to go with family as they have something for everyone.
    By silvia ruiz, April 18, 2017
  • Our family loves ordering pizza from romeo's. Thick topping and fresh made sauce.
    By kurtis, October 30, 2016
  • Very nice. Our server was lovely. One piece of sole yummy. The second piece I had to leave. My plate was all messy around the rim and underneath.
    By Ann Baker, August 07, 2016
  • ☆ ☆ ☆ ☆
    Wasted a half hour waiting for staff once we were seated NOT even a glass of water. I do NOT recommend. Many other places to choose from.
    By Ralph Rebain, July 12, 2016
How would you rate this?

Photo gallery of Romeo's Place

About Romeo's Place in Duncan

Romeo's Place is a food and restaurant in Duncan, British Columbia. Romeo's Place is located at 180 Trans-Canada Highway.

Entertainments nearby

Maybe you will be interested